APEA PREDICTOR EXAM WITH ACTUAL
CORRECT ANSWERS.

What is the recommended treatment for chronic bacterial prostatitis? -
CorreCt Answers -a fluoroquinolone (cipro or levo) + bactrim



What is the recommended treatment for acute prostatitis? - CorreCt
Answers -cipro (if not STI related) or ceftriaxone



What are s/s of an intraductal breast papilloma? - CorreCt Answers -clear
to bloody unilateral nipple discharge (bilateral is usually benign), and also a
wart like lump palpated in the nipple area


If a patient has GABHS but has an allergy to penicillins, what is the second
line option? - CorreCt Answers -first generation cephalosporins, unless the
allergy is severe, then you would consider macrolides like a -mycin


PDE5 inhibitors (sildenafil, tadalafil) are contraindicated in which patient
populations? - CorreCt Answers -in those who are on any type of nitrate or
triptan because it could result in hypotension


What class of drug is sildenafil (viagra)? - CorreCt Answers -a PDE5
inhibitor which can cause hypotension so you should do a full cardiac
assessment before starting a patient on this and maybe do an EKG


What are the symptoms of peripheral artery disease? - CorreCt Answers -
think P meaning pain, A meaning absent or weak pulses, eschar or shiny
legs, intermittent claudication

,What is first line treatment for PAD? - CorreCt Answers -walking and
physical activity to improve circulation. second line is an aspirin or anti-
platelet


What should we tell our patients with PAD NOT to do? - CorreCt Answers -
do not elevate the feet; keep them down


How do we diagnose PAD? - CorreCt Answers -an ABI < 7; doppler can also
be used to diagnose as well but is the second choice


What are s/s of peripheral vascular disease? - CorreCt Answers -think V
meaning volume overload aka edema, may ache or be uncomfortable but is
not painful, bounding pulses, ruddy discoloration


If a patient is on Coumadin but then they may need to go on an antibiotic
for an infection and Bactrim is the drug of choice, what should you do? -
CorreCt Answers -Bactrim increases INR so we would want to decrease the
coumadin dose while the patient is on this


If a patient is on Coumadin but then they may need to go on Rifampin,
what should you do? - CorreCt Answers -Rifampin decreases INR so we'd
want to increase the coumadin dose


If a patient on coumadin's INR is 3.1-4 ,what should you do? - CorreCt
Answers -decrease the weekly dose by 5-10%

, If a patient on coumadin's INR is 4.1-5.0, what should you do? - CorreCt
Answers -hold one dose then decrease the weekly dose by 10%



If a patient's INR is greater than 5, what should you do? - CorreCt Answers
-consult cards, likely would hold two doses then decrease the weekly dose


An anorexic patient will have a BMI of what? - CorreCt Answers -less than
18


What is primary amenorrhea? - CorreCt Answers -when the patient has
never gotten their period before (there is an absence of menarche) but they
have all of their secondary sex characteristics


Secondary amenorrhea is a lack of menses after _________ of not having
a period; but you have had one before - CorreCt Answers -3 months


What do we need to do first when a patient comes in with secondary
amenorrhea? - CorreCt Answers -rule out pregnancy


Anorexia can put you at risk for what? - CorreCt Answers -osteoporosis,
amenorrhea, cardiac damage


Amenorrhea is considered a risk factor for what? - CorreCt Answers -
osteoporosis


What is the best indication of an anorexic patient doing better? They tell
you they are eating more, they have weight gain, or they get their period
back? - CorreCt Answers -they get their period back
